/*
 * RestockPilot client setup — for external plugin authors.
 * This client talks to the Corridor restock-planning API: it pulls
 * machine inventory snapshots, predicts sell-through, and returns a
 * suggested restock route. Plugins must call init() before any
 * planner methods. Rate limit: 60 req/min per plugin. Sandbox data
 * only; production machines are off-limits. Initialize the client
 * with the key below.
 */

API key for bahop-yajog: qvz3-mhf

## DeployDora Bot — Reviewer Onboarding

DeployDora is Kestrel Forge's chat bot reporting deploy status to the #releases channel. For your security review, note that the bot's credential store is sealed with a hardware token held by the release captain, with a documented recovery path audited each quarter. Should the token be lost, recovery requires the passphrase maintained in this onboarding record, reproduced below.

strongbox words: gilok-druion-briath-wendor-briion-prawyn-fenion-oliir-casdor-holius-briius-gilath-gilael-pelys

Subject: DR drill notes — queue migration

Team,

Tuesday's drill covered failover for the new Conveyor queue replacing our homegrown dispatcher. Failover completed in four minutes; two stuck jobs were replayed cleanly. One action item: restoring the dead-letter archive requires the recovery passphrase, which for the drill record is noted below:

strongbox words: fenwyn-lamix-novael-holeth-sorix-druael-lamwyn

## Break-Glass: Lintharbor Baseline File

Release managers: if the static-analysis baseline (`lintharbor.baseline`) gets corrupted and blocks the release train, don't hand-edit it. Use break-glass to regenerate it from the last green build — yes, it's allowed, just log it afterward. Grab the sealed regeneration token and authenticate with the passphrase below.

recovery phrase for yagaf-yadup: wenax-kelion-kaswyn